MD96-2084 (MD962084) * Latitude: -31.741667 * Longitude: 15.516667 * Date/Time: 1996-10-03T00:00:00 * Elevation: -1408.0 m * Recovery: 35.28 m * Location: Namaqualand, off Olifants River * Campaign: MD105 (IMAGES II) * Basis: Marion Dufresne (1995) * Method/Device: Calypso Corer (CALYPSO) * Comment: Pale olive grey Foram-bearing Nannofossil Ooze. Partly very soft, great loss at the top during core handling on deck. The upper part probably contains mud debris flows or piston inflow.
